Question 27 Sleep Country is a Canadian specialty mattress retailer. The following information (all amounts in thousands) can be found on its recent balance sheets December 31, December 31, December 31, 2012 2016 2015 Cash $23,620 $23,820 $16,639 Trade and other receivables 14,002 14,937 8,406 Inventories 38,275 34,538 32,070 Prepaid expenses and deposits 1,833 2,399 2,087 Property and equipment 52,773 33,927 28,987 Other long-term assets 351,945 351,387 351,178 Trade and other payables 52,406 40,522 46,024 Customer deposits 19,587 17,554 15,598 Other current liabilities 662 445 725 Non-current liabilities 142,985 151,187 143,429 Shareholders' equity 266,808 251,300 233,591 Calculate Sleep Country's working capital, current ratio, and acid-test ratio for each period (Enter working capital amounts in thousands. Enter negative amounts using either a negative sign preceding the number w.g. -45 or parentheses e.o. (45). Round current ratio and acid-test ratio answers to 2 decimal places 1.7541) December 31, 2017 December 31, 2016 December 31, 2015 Working Capital Current Ratio Acid-test Ratio 11 Calculate Sleep Country's current assets and current liabilities for each period. (Enter amounts in thousands.) December 31, 2017 December 31, 2016 December 31, 2015 Current assets $ Current liabilities $
